    Once through the big slotted ear, the 560m long tunnel. Here you can take great pictures and in winter you can experience an amazing ice spectacle at the entrance. Large icicles have formed and sometimes hang down bizarrely from the walls.

      Big Rascal Bike Tunnel - Bats attraction

      Formerly Schalkenmehren Tunnel

      About 2 km from Daun station, over the viaduct, past the Mühlenberg, the "Lützelbacher Kopf" (507 m above sea level) was underpassed by a 560 m long tunnel. The construction - commissioned by the Royal Railway Directorate Saarbrücken, was carried out by the Hochtief company in 1907 - 1909. The tunnel is lined with Eifel basalt. In 1988 the Daun - Wittlich railway line was shut down, and in 1999 the Maare-Moselle cycle path was opened. The tunnel is illuminated today and bears the inscription "Big Slit Ear" at the entrance, which indicates a species of bat that has settled in the tunnel. Length 560 meters. It is 560 m long, making it the second longest tunnel that you can cycle through in Germany. That is why there is hardly any daylight in the middle of the tunnel. Lamps have therefore been installed for pedestrians and cyclists. A few rare visitors, however, appreciate the darkness: bats! The pipistrelle and brown long-eared bat hibernate in a wooden crate under the ceiling at the north end of the tunnel. Whiskered bats, water bats and napped bats sleep through the winter in the rest of the tunnel vault.
